Gravel Adventure: Tavullia to Gabicce Mare


A gravel cycling route starting from Tavullia

Embark on a thrilling gravel journey along the Adriatic coast and charming seaside towns

Map

This gravel cycling route starts near Tavullia and heads towards Gabicce Mare, offering a unique way to explore the Adriatic coastline. The route covers a total ascent of 383 meters and spans a distance of 41 kilometers. It is suitable for gravel enthusiasts looking for a scenic coastal adventure.

Start: Tavullia Village center
Tavullia: A legendary locality for cyclists and Valentino Rossi fans.
Tavullia, located in the Marche region of Italy, is a popular destination for cycling enthusiasts. From the perspective of a road and gravel cyclist, Tavullia offers diverse terrains, including flat sections for fast-paced riding and challenging climbs for those seeking a more intense workout. The locality is also home to the famous motorcycle racer Valentino Rossi, and his fans often visit Tavullia as part of their pilgrimage. For tourists, Tavullia has various attractions, including the VR46 Academy and the Valentino Rossi Museum. With its cycling-friendly environment and renowned connections to the world of racing, Tavullia receives a high rank of 5 in terms of suitability for cyclists.
